Separation Roller Release Mechanism

The separation roller [A] is normally away from the feed roller [B]. When the paper
feed station is selected, the separation roller solenoid [C] contacts the separation
roller with the feed roller as explained on the previous two pages.
This contact/release mechanism has the following three advantages:
1. When the paper feed motor turns on, all the separation rollers in the three feed
stations rotate. If the separation roller is away from the feed roller, it reduces
the load on the paper feed motor and drive mechanism, and it also reduces
wear to the rubber surface of the separation roller caused by friction between
the separation roller and the feed roller.
2. After paper feed is completed, paper sometimes remains between the feed and
separation rollers. If the feed tray is drawn out in this condition, this paper might
be torn. When the separation roller is away from the feed roller, the remaining
paper can be removed from between the rollers.
3. When paper misfeeds occur around this area, the user can easily pull out the
jammed paper between the feed and the separation rollers if the separation
roller is away from the feed roller.
After paper feed and the paper feed clutch tuns off, the paper feed motor still turns
the separation roller [A] in reverse. The separation roller, still contacting the feed
roller, turns the feed roller in reverse for 100 ms. Then the separation solenoid
turns off.
